Summit Healthcare Regional Medical Center Trusted to deliver exceptional, compassionate care close to home.

Summit Healthcare is a not-for-profit healthcare organization in the beautiful White Mountains of Northeastern Arizona. As a regional medical center with 101 licensed beds, Summit Healthcare responds to the health care needs of more than 90,000 permanent and seasonal residents living in a 3,000 square mile area. Our goal is quite simple—to provide patients with exceptional, state-of-the-art healthcare, close to home. For the past 50 years, Summit Healthcare has taken critical steps to achieve this goal by investing millions of dollars in equipment and technology and by attracting an outstanding physicians representing a wide variety of specialties. As the seasons change, it’s important to keep the whole family feeling their best. Here are a few simple habits to help you enjoy fall to the fullest:

- Stay active together
Cooler weather makes it a great time for walks, bike rides, or playing outside. Even 20 minutes a day can give your immune system a boost.

- Eat seasonal foods
Fall favorites like apples, carrots, and sweet potatoes are packed with vitamins. Get kids involved by letting them help prepare a healthy snack or meal.

- Practice good hand hygiene
Regular handwashing, especially after school, sports, or errands, remains one of the easiest ways to prevent the spread of germs.

- Make rest a priority
With school, sports, and holidays, routines can get busy. A consistent bedtime helps kids (and adults) recharge and stay well.

Today is World Su***de Prevention Day. 💛 At Summit Healthcare, we care about the health and well-being of every member of our community. Su***de is a serious concern that can affect anyone, and it’s important to know that help and support are available.

If you or someone you love is struggling, please reach out. Resources include:

- National Su***de & Crisis Lifeline: Dial or text 988

- Crisis Text Line: Text HOME to 741741

- Senior Behavioral Health Support: For adults 55+, contact our Senior Behavioral Health team at 928-537-6890

Reaching out for support is a sign of strength. Summit Healthcare encourages everyone to check in on friends, neighbors, and loved ones, and to seek help when needed. Together, we can foster a caring and supportive community.
